Town in Maharashtra, India


Vita, also known as Vite, is a town and a municipal council in Sangli district in the Indian state of Maharashtra. Vita is also taluka headquarters of Khanapur taluka.[3][4]

Demographics

As of the 2011 Indian census, Vita had a population of 48,289, of which 24,692 were males and 23,597 were females. The population in the age group of 0 to 6 years was 5,321. The average literacy rate was 77.65% of which male literacy was 81.58% and the female literacy rate was 73.57%. Scheduled Castes and Scheduled Tribes have a population of 6,628 and 402 respectively. There were 10328 households in Vita in 2011.[1]

Languages

Marathi is the most commonly spoken language. Hindi and English were also spoken, in addition to some community-specific languages.[5]

Transport

By Road

Vita is connected to urban settlements like Palus (27km), Tasgaon (32km) and Karad (42km) by road network.

By Railway

Nearest District HQ railway station Sangli is 53 km from Vita. Plenty of rikshas and private taxis are available from Vita to Sangli railway station. [6]Sangli station is the nearest major railway station, about 53 km (33 mi) away on the Mumbai–Bangalore main line. Sangli railway station is also connected to the city via bus services. Swachh survekshan awards

Vita was ranked 9th in both the west zone and the state for Best City in 'Innovation & Best Practices' in 2020.[7]

In the Swachh Survekshan Awards 2021, Vita ranked top in the cleanest city (in less than one lakh population category) of the India.[8]
